What they do

An Account Manager manages client accounts for a company. Develops and maintains communication with company clients, promotes sales and services, and works to resolve problems Accounts may be for product sales, advertising or marketing services or financial services such as banking.

Surety Account Manager Hybrid - South Jersey (Greater Philadelphia) Salary range: $65,000 - $85,000 Reports to: Director of Surety We are seeking an experienced professional from the surety bond space that have exposure to middle-large markets. With a footprint expanding along the East Coast, this established and growing insurance agency offers flexibility and annual bonus opportunities, emphasizes professional development and come highly rated by current and past employees.
Overview of Responsibilities:
Collaborate with
Leadership:
Partner with the Surety Director and Bond Billing Account Administrator to ensure timely, accurate, and high-quality execution of assigned responsibilities.
Deliver Exceptional Client Service:
Respond to client inquiries and manage policy administration, billing, claims coordination, and coverage-related requests.
Manage Policy Lifecycle:
Oversee policy expirations, renewals, and related documentation to ensure uninterrupted coverage and compliance.
Coordinate Renewal Activities:
Conduct client and market research, prepare submissions, negotiate coverage terms, and develop and present renewal proposals.
Support Accounts Receivable Efforts:
Review aging reports, follow up on outstanding balances, and assist in the collection of delinquent accounts.
